Zimbabwe Resumes E-Passport Services

Zimbabwe Registrar General’s Office has resumed E-passport service.


The Registrar General’s Office has resumed processing new e-passport applications after a technical glitch on the main database triggered temporary suspension of the process which also included the issuance of birth and death certificates.
They are receiving new e-passport applications and everything is now back to normal, according to reports.


The resumption of service started on Wednesday after the engineers restored a major glitch on the main database.


The issuance of births and death certificates has also been restored, hence the public is advised to visit the nearest Registrar General’s office to acquire the necessary national identification documentation.
